What is the Varanasi Taxi Full Day Price?
The Varanasi taxi full day price depends on the vehicle type, travel duration, and total kilometers.
Estimated Full-Day Taxi Fare (2026)
| Vehicle Type | Seating Capacity | Approx. Full-Day Price (8 Hours / 80 KM) |
|---|---|---|
| Hatchback | 4 | ₹1,800 – ₹2,200 |
| Sedan (Dzire/Etios) | 4 | ₹2,000 – ₹2,600 |
| SUV (Ertiga/Bolero) | 6–7 | ₹2,800 – ₹3,500 |
| Innova Crysta | 6–7 | ₹4,000 – ₹5,500 |
| Tempo Traveller | 12–17 | ₹6,000 – ₹9,000 |
Note: Additional charges may apply for extra kilometers, tolls, parking, and driver allowance if your trip exceeds the package limits.
Which Places Are Covered in a Local Sightseeing Tour?
Most cab for sightseeing Varanasi packages include the city’s major attractions.
Popular Sightseeing Itinerary
| Attraction | Approx. Visit Time |
|---|---|
| Kashi Vishwanath Temple | 1–2 Hours |
| Kal Bhairav Temple | 30–45 Minutes |
| Sankat Mochan Temple | 45 Minutes |
| Durga Temple | 30 Minutes |
| Tulsi Manas Mandir | 30 Minutes |
| BHU Campus | 45 Minutes |
| Bharat Kala Bhavan | 45 Minutes |
| Assi Ghat | 45 Minutes |
| Dashashwamedh Ghat | 1 Hour |
| Sarnath | 2–3 Hours |
You can also customize your itinerary based on your interests and available time.

Tips to Save Money on Local Cab Booking
Book in Advance
Advance bookings usually provide better vehicle availability and transparent pricing.
Travel on Weekdays
Demand is generally lower on weekdays than during weekends and festivals.
Choose the Right Package
If you only plan to visit a few places, consider a half-day package instead of a full-day booking.
Confirm Inclusions
Ask whether the quoted fare includes:
- Fuel
- Driver charges
- Parking fees
- Toll taxes
- State taxes (if applicable)

Can I include Sarnath in a one-day tour?
Yes. Sarnath is around 10–12 km from central Varanasi and is commonly included in a full-day sightseeing itinerary.
